§ 10-13-5. Citations to state as creditor.
Every person imprisoned or liable to be imprisoned in any suit in favor of the state, entitled to the oath prescribed in § 10-13-8, may apply for and have a citation to the state, to show cause why he or she should not be admitted to take the debtor's oath.

Legislative History
G.L. 1896, ch. 260, § 25; G.L. 1909, ch. 326, § 25; G.L. 1923, ch. 377, § 25; G.L. 1938, ch. 563, § 25; G.L. 1956, § 10-13-5.
